Forensic Schedule Analysis and Discretionary Logic Presented by John Livengood, Navigant Let's face it: Forensic Schedule Analysis (FSA) and real-time schedule review do not handle CPM schedules with significant amounts of discretionary logic very well. Major theoretical and practical advancements have been made on what FSA methodology is most appropriate to evaluate schedule delay in the last decade, largely through the introduction of AACE's RP29R-03. Nevertheless, discretionary logic - the type of logic that is not dictated by either the contract or the physical necessity of the project - continues to cause difficulty for fair and accurate analysis of schedule updates during the course of the project in the construction industry. Further, these analytical problems persist in the methodologies associated with post-construction FSA. This program will help you: - Understand contractual, mandatory and discretionary logic

Forensic Schedule Analysis on Risk-Adjusted Schedules Presented by John Livengood and Patrick Kelly, Navigant It is likely that risk-adjusted schedules will expand beyond their current uses and become more common in buildings and infrastructure construction, as time and cost pressure from owners increases. As this happens, what will be the impact on Forensic Schedule Analysis (FSA), as more risk-adjusted schedules form the basis of delay claims? Risk-adjusted CPM schedules use computer modeling to analyze the likely fluctuation of activity durations resulting from a range of uncertainties and risks, and then analyze the effects of the variations on the schedules float as different chains of activities are given different durations and the amount of float changes. The result is a schedule that has a series of potential critical paths with varying degrees of likelihood, rather than a single Critical Path and sub-critical paths. FSA, however, is predicated on identifying the "single" contemporaneous critical path, often defined as the path with zero float. So what happens when the CPM schedule series has been risk-adjusted so that float is variable and more activities paths are critical?
